dominant

/หˆdษ’mษชnษ™nt/
noun
  1. 1

    The fifth major tone of a musical scale (five major steps above the note in question); thus G is the dominant of C, A of D, and so on.

  2. 2

    The triad built on the dominant tone.

  3. 3

    A gene that is dominant.

  4. 4

    A species or organism that is dominant.

  5. 5

    (BDSM) The dominating partner in sadomasochistic sexual activity.

Synonyms

adjective
  1. 1

    Ruling; governing; prevailing

    โ€œThe dominant party controlled the government.โ€

  2. 2

    Predominant, common, prevalent, of greatest importance.

    โ€œThe dominant plants of the Carboniferous were lycopods and early conifers.โ€

  3. 3

    Designating the follicle which will survive atresia and permit ovulation.
